1637 • NETHERLANDS
$1B+

in today’s dollars

Tulip Mania

Single tulip bulbs traded for the price of a luxury house. Contracts were bought and sold with zero delivery — pure speculation. Prices collapsed 99% overnight when reality hit.

1720 • BRITAIN
Massive

ruin for thousands

South Sea Bubble

Company promised insane riches from South American trade. Stock soared 1,000% on rumors. Crashed when no real profits materialized. Parliament had to step in.

1920 • USA
$20M

real money then

Charles Ponzi Scheme

Promised 50% returns in 45 days using international postal coupons. Paid early investors with new money. Collapsed when new money dried up. Gave the scam its name.

1997 • CANADA/INDONESIA
$6B+

market value wiped out

Bre-X Gold Scandal

Mining company claimed the world’s biggest gold deposit. Stock exploded 400x. Samples were salted with gold dust. Exposed when core samples showed nothing. Investors lost billions.

2001 • USA
$74B

shareholder value destroyed

Enron Accounting Fraud

Energy giant hid billions in debt using off-balance-sheet partnerships and mark-to-market accounting tricks. Stock went from $90 to pennies. Bankruptcy wiped out pensions and jobs.

2008 • USA
$65B+

investor losses

Bernie Madoff Ponzi Scheme

Ran for decades promising steady 10-12% returns. Used new investor money to pay old ones. Collapsed in the 2008 crisis. Largest Ponzi in history. Destroyed charities and families.

2015 • USA
$600M+

raised on lies

Theranos / Elizabeth Holmes

Promised revolutionary blood tests from a single drop. Valued at $9B. Tech didn’t work. Lied to investors, patients, and regulators. Holmes convicted of fraud.

2022 • USA
$8B+

customer funds misused

FTX Crypto Collapse

Sam Bankman-Fried ran the exchange like his personal piggy bank. Misused billions in customer deposits to fund political donations, real estate, and risky bets. Total meltdown.

My 7 Red Flag Checklist (Run if you see 2+)

  • 01 Pressure to act “today only” — real opportunities wait for due diligence.
  • 02 Promises of returns that beat the market with zero volatility.
  • 03 Testimonials from people you can’t verify or who are paid affiliates.
  • 04 “Secret” strategies they won’t explain until you pay.
  • 05 The pitch focuses on lifestyle, not the actual math.
  • 06 They hate on “boring” businesses or index funds.
  • 07 No skin in the game — the promoter isn’t all-in himself.
